Countertop oral irrigators remain the leading type, accounting for approximately 42% of global demand in 2025, supported by larger reservoirs, stronger pressure delivery, multiple settings, and suitability for multi-user households. Their performance advantage is particularly relevant for orthodontic and periodontal cleaning, where longer operating cycles and specialized tips improve usability. Cordless/handheld models follow closely and are expanding faster, with adoption increasing approximately 15–18% as rechargeable batteries and compact pump systems improve portability.
Hybrid flosser-plus-toothbrush devices represent the strongest emerging product shift, benefiting from multifunctionality and reduced countertop footprint. Ultra-portable/travel models remain strategically relevant for frequent travelers, while replacement tips create recurring accessory demand. Manufacturers are therefore balancing countertop investment around performance with cordless investment around mobility and convenience.
Home care represents the dominant application, accounting for approximately 64% of market demand, as consumers increasingly incorporate powered interdental cleaning into daily preventive routines. The application benefits from easier device availability, lower dependence on professional visits, and expanding awareness of gum and orthodontic care. Dentistry remains the fastest-growing application, supported by greater use of oral irrigators in orthodontic maintenance, periodontal care, implant aftercare, and patient education. Approximately 15% of adoption momentum is increasingly linked to professional recommendation and treatment-related use.
The distinction between applications is becoming more operational: home users prioritize portability, noise reduction, and intuitive controls, whereas dental settings prioritize pressure consistency, specialized tips, durability, and clinical usability. Manufacturers are responding with separate consumer and professional product architectures rather than one universal design.

Waterpik competes directly with Philips Sonicare and Panasonic as global technology leaders, while Oclean, Church & Dwight’s oral-care portfolio, and regional OEMs compete through value pricing, portability, and channel reach. The top five players hold an estimated 55% combined share, leaving fragmented space for specialists. Competition centers on technology and price: smart-pressure features command roughly 15–20% premium positioning, while cordless models can reduce retail price gaps by 10–15% through simplified reservoirs and electronics. Players are expanding cordless portfolios, partnering with dental networks, integrating sensors, and strengthening accessory ecosystems. Panasonic differentiates through ultrasonic technology; Philips emphasizes guided pulse systems; Waterpik leverages clinical positioning and broad tip compatibility. The competitive shift is moving from basic water pressure toward personalized, quieter, multifunctional devices. Entry barriers include clinical validation, brand trust, distribution relationships, and component sourcing. Winners will combine proven cleaning performance, efficient supply chains, differentiated cordless technology, and strong professional-channel credibility at scale.

Oral irrigator technology is shifting from conventional pressure-pump systems toward ultrasonic, pulse-wave, nano-bubble, and sensor-controlled platforms. Panasonic’s nanoCLEANSE technology reports eightfold cleaning efficiency versus conventional water-jet performance, while Philips Quad Stream technology uses four-stream coverage and pulse guidance. These architectures can improve cleaning consistency by 10–20% and support premium differentiation. Cordless adoption is also accelerating as USB charging and compact lithium-battery systems reduce footprint and simplify deployment. Waterpik’s platforms add automated pressure progression, quieter operation, personalized profiles, and multiple intensity settings, moving devices closer to adaptive preventive-care tools.

July 2024 Panasonic introduced a new ultrasonic oral-irrigator range using clinically tested technology and multiple specialized nozzles. The launch strengthened premium positioning around gentle cleaning and targeted care, supporting broader adoption of rechargeable devices across European personal-care channels. Source: panasonic.com
October 2024 Philips partnered with Aspen Dental to place Sonicare solutions across more than 1,100 dental locations, including its Cordless Power Flosser. The agreement expanded professional access, strengthened recommendation-led purchasing, and connected clinical channels with at-home interdental-care products. Source: philips.com
September 2025 Waterpik reported a six-week randomized trial of its Promax water flosser involving 105 participants; 80% using setting 9 reduced gingival bleeding below 10%. The evidence significantly strengthens clinical positioning and supports premium adoption among professional-recommended users. Source: waterpik.com
2025 Church & Dwight transitioned WATERPIK packaging sold in Europe and the United Kingdom to sourced paperboard, advancing packaging sustainability. The shift reduces material exposure and strengthens ESG positioning across Waterpik channels while supporting packaging expectations. Source: churchdwight.com
